1. Enhance User Engagement: Explore Gamification Techniques in Mental Wellness Software

Gamification techniques are revolutionizing mental wellness software by turning the journey of self-care into an engaging and interactive experience. Imagine users embarking on a quest where each daily meditation earns them points, unlocking new levels in a virtual landscape rich with personalized challenges. According to a study published in the journal "Computers in Human Behavior," gamified elements can increase engagement levels by over 60%, significantly enhancing user satisfaction and adherence to wellness routines ). Features like progress tracking, reward systems, and community competitions not only motivate users but also foster a sense of belonging and achievement, crucial elements in promoting mental health.

Moreover, integrating gamification with established psychological theories can amplify its effectiveness. The Self-Determination Theory posits that people are motivated by autonomy, competence, and relatedness. Mental wellness applications, such as Happify, utilize these principles by allowing users to choose activities that resonate with their personal goals, thus enhancing their agency. A survey conducted on 8,000 users of Happify found that 86% reported improved well-being after several weeks of engagement with gamified content ). By marrying technology with psychological insights, mental wellness software not only entertains but also empowers users, transforming the mundane into an enriching journey toward mental resilience.

2. Implement Real-Time Feedback: Leverage Data-Driven Insights to Improve User Satisfaction

Implementing real-time feedback within mental wellness software can significantly enhance user engagement and satisfaction by leveraging data-driven insights. For instance, platforms like Headspace utilize user feedback during sessions to adapt meditation exercises in real time, thereby personalizing the experience to the user’s preferences and emotional state. Studies, such as the one conducted by Michie et al. (2011), highlight the importance of tailoring interventions based on user input, which not only increases satisfaction but also promotes adherence to wellness practices. By using algorithms that analyze user behavior and emotions, software can immediately adjust recommendations, akin to personalized learning experiences in educational technology. Reliable platforms can integrate this feature through APIs that gather and analyze user data effectively, as exemplified by platforms like Moodfit, which provide users with instant insights based on their self-reported moods .

To fully capitalize on the benefits of real-time feedback, mental wellness applications should implement iterative improvement cycles based on user data. For example, applications could incorporate daily check-ins that track mood variations, echoing methods found in proven behavioral therapies, such as Dialectical Behavior Therapy (DBT). Research published in the Journal of Medical Internet Research underscores that continuous monitoring and feedback can significantly enhance user retention rates and therapeutic outcomes . As a practical recommendation, developers should consider integrating features that allow users to set personalized goals, paired with real-time notifications to encourage ongoing engagement, similar to fitness trackers that offer reminders to achieve physical health objectives.

4. Incorporate Telehealth Features: Study the Impact of Virtual Therapy on User Engagement

Incorporating telehealth features into mental wellness software can significantly enhance user engagement by addressing the growing demand for accessible therapy options. Studies have shown that virtual therapy platforms, such as Talkspace and BetterHelp, lead to higher user satisfaction rates due to their convenience and flexibility. For instance, a study published in the *Journal of Medical Internet Research* found that clients who engaged in teletherapy reported lower dropout rates and higher overall satisfaction than those attending in-person sessions . This effectiveness can be attributed to attributes like session flexibility and the ability to connect from the comfort of one's home, resembling the ease of streaming a favorite show versus attending a movie screening.

To further enhance user engagement, mental wellness software can incorporate features like real-time chat support, video calls, and progress tracking tools. For example, the app Sanvello combines cognitive behavioral therapy techniques with real-time mood tracking and community support, effectively fostering a sense of belonging among users. A systematic review in *Psychological Services* indicated that users who employed such interactive elements were more likely to sustain regular use of mental health applications, improving their engagement significantly . By implementing telehealth features alongside interactive tools, software developers can create a more immersive experience for users, akin to engaging with their favorite social media platforms, ultimately leading to better mental health outcomes.

6. Prioritize Data Security: Review Best Practices to Establish Trust and Improve User Engagement

Prioritizing data security is essential for mental wellness software developers aiming to enhance user trust and engagement. With the increasing prevalence of data breaches, users are increasingly concerned about the confidentiality of their personal information. Implementing best practices such as end-to-end encryption, regular security audits, and robust user authentication processes can significantly elevate a user's sense of safety. For instance, platforms like Talkspace have adopted strict data protection protocols, ensuring that all communications remain secure and private, which has been pivotal in maintaining user trust . A robust security framework not only protects user data but can also serve as a distinguishing feature that encourages user loyalty and engagement in a saturated market.

To further boost user confidence, mental wellness software can incorporate transparent privacy policies and user-friendly security settings. For example, the Headspace app allows users to manage their data preferences easily and understand how their information is used, fostering a sense of control and security. Research indicates that users are more likely to engage with platforms that prioritize data security, leading to higher satisfaction rates . Developers should regularly review and update their security practices based on emerging technologies and user feedback. By treating data security not just as a compliance issue but as a core feature, mental wellness applications can build lasting relationships with their users and improve overall satisfaction.
